HomeTown Bank
HomeTown Bank received 372 applications in 2025 and made 318 mortgages, in 56 counties across 4 states. The median rate its borrowers got was 6.750% on a median loan of $175,000. Of 334 decisions, 14 were denials — 4.2%, most often for credit history.

By loan purpose
| Purpose | Mortgages made | Median rate | Median loan | Denied |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Home purchase | 166 | 6.562% | $215,000 | 3.5% |
| Refinancing | 31 | 6.700% | $305,000 | 0.0% |
| Cash-out refinancing | 64 | 6.845% | $120,000 | 7.2% |
| Other purposes | 57 | 7.105% | $45,000 | 5.0% |

Counts, medians and denial shares are computed from the Home Mortgage Disclosure Act loan-level file for 2025, published by the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au through the FFIEC: every application a covered lender received, as the lender reported it. A median rate is what borrowers got, not what you will be offered — it depends on the loan, the property, your credit and the market on the day, and no figure here is a quote. A median over fewer than 10 loans is not shown: it is a number with no meaning and a real person's rate half-exposed. Those cells say "under 10 loans" and the count is still published.
